ABSTRACT
AIM:
To investigate the protective effect of rifampicin on rotenone-induced apoptosis of dopaminergic neurons and expression of ?-synuclein in rats.METHODS:
Highly selective lesions and high expression of ?-synuclein in nigrostriatal dopaminergic neurons in rats were induced by chronic subcutaneous exposure to rotenone at dose of 1.5 mg?kg-1?d-1 for 3 weeks.At the same time,rifampicin was administered at dose of 30 mg?kg-1?d-1 by intragastric administration for 3 weeks.The changes of behavior,pathology and immunoreactivity of TH and ?-synuclein in SNc were observed.RESULTS:
Obvious changes of behavior,pathology and TH immunoreactivity in SNc were observed in male SD rats injected subcutaneously with rotenone and rifampicin protected rats against these toxic effects induced by rotenone.CONCLUSION:
Rifampicin has extensive protective effects against rotenone-induced neurotoxicity,which is related to inhibiting the expression and aggregation of ?-synuclein.
